diff --git a/lib/node_modules/@stdlib/_tools/licenses/licenses/lib/recurse.js b/lib/node_modules/@stdlib/_tools/licenses/licenses/lib/recurse.js index 82041357487d..b8a69c0d87b5 100644 --- a/lib/node_modules/@stdlib/_tools/licenses/licenses/lib/recurse.js +++ b/lib/node_modules/@stdlib/_tools/licenses/licenses/lib/recurse.js @@ -97,12 +97,12 @@ function recurse( cache, pkg ) { results.licenses = []; } else { debug( '%s has license information.', id ); - results.licenses = new Array( licenses.length ); + results.licenses = []; for ( i = 0; i < licenses.length; i++ ) { - results.licenses[ i ] = { + results.licenses.push({ 'src': fpath, 'name': licenses[ i ] - }; + }); } } // Insert the package results into the results cache: diff --git a/lib/node_modules/@stdlib/utils/async/reduce/benchmark/benchmark.js b/lib/node_modules/@stdlib/utils/async/reduce/benchmark/benchmark.js index c8858a587802..6dc618c5ee88 100644 --- a/lib/node_modules/@stdlib/utils/async/reduce/benchmark/benchmark.js +++ b/lib/node_modules/@stdlib/utils/async/reduce/benchmark/benchmark.js @@ -21,6 +21,7 @@ // MODULES // var bench = require( '@stdlib/bench' ); +var filledarray = require( '@stdlib/array/filled' ); var EPS = require( '@stdlib/constants/float64/eps' ); var pkg = require( './../package.json' ).name; var reduceAsync = require( './../lib' ); @@ -31,7 +32,6 @@ var reduceAsync = require( './../lib' ); bench( pkg, function benchmark( b ) { var arr; var acc; - var len; var i; function onItem( acc, v, i, clbk ) { @@ -41,11 +41,7 @@ bench( pkg, function benchmark( b ) { clbk( null, acc ); } } - arr = new Array( 100 ); - len = arr.length; - for ( i = 0; i < len; i++ ) { - arr[ i ] = EPS; - } + arr = filledarray( EPS, 100, 'generic' ); i = 0; b.tic(); @@ -73,7 +69,6 @@ bench( pkg+':series=false', function benchmark( b ) { var opts; var arr; var acc; - var len; var i; function onItem( acc, v, i, clbk ) { @@ -86,11 +81,7 @@ bench( pkg+':series=false', function benchmark( b ) { opts = { 'series': false }; - arr = new Array( 100 ); - len = arr.length; - for ( i = 0; i < len; i++ ) { - arr[ i ] = EPS; - } + arr = filledarray( EPS, 100, 'generic' ); i = 0; b.tic(); @@ -117,7 +108,6 @@ bench( pkg+':series=false', function benchmark( b ) { bench( pkg+':limit=3', function benchmark( b ) { var opts; var arr; - var len; var acc; var i; @@ -131,11 +121,7 @@ bench( pkg+':limit=3', function benchmark( b ) { opts = { 'limit': 3 }; - arr = new Array( 100 ); - len = arr.length; - for ( i = 0; i < len; i++ ) { - arr[ i ] = EPS; - } + arr = filledarray( EPS, 100, 'generic' ); i = 0; b.tic();